Meet Your Hosts
CloseFor Jim and Donna Rankin, owners of the Hixton / Alma Center KOA in Wisconsin, the camping world offered the allure of freedom.
Tired of the corporate world, and feeling the desire to be their own boss, Jim and Donna took a road trip in 1987 and stayed at their first KOA. While there, they envisioned the changes they would make to the campground if it were theirs. After returning from their road trip, the Rankin's decided to contact KOA to see if any campgrounds were for sale.
Unsure that they could afford to purchase a campground, Jim and Donna didn't know if their dream was going to become a reality. KOA contacted them about a fixer-upper, and it has been their total life ever since. This year marks the 24th anniversary of their entrance into the campground business.
"The business runs us," says Jim with pride. "And we love it that way."
Avid gardeners, Jim and Donna are especially proud of the campground gardens. They have planted well over 4000 bushes and trees and even more flowering plants. They have had "workampers," to help them the past 10 years, but before that, they handled it alone.
Campers tell them, they return not only because it is a beautiful campground, but that it is so peaceful and the atmosphere's friendly.
